The anchor is a piece of jewelry that's inserted into the skin to keep the piercing in place. There are two types of anchors: One has two little "feet" that extend from both sides (also known as a footed dermal anchor) while the other type has a simple, round base. The whole procedure to remove these dermal piercings takes about 20 minutes. Once the dermal piercings have been in place for awhile (this patient had them in for several years), the body makes scar tissue around the anchors under the skin. This scar tissue, called a capsule, needs to be released in order to remove the dermal jewelry. A dermal piercing appears on flat areas of the skin, like the cheekbone or above the collarbone. They are single-entry piercings, which means that there is no exit hole. Instead, a dermal anchor is fitted beneath the skin, and the dermal top is screwed directly in. Dermal anchors often feature a "foot"—an elongated end—for a more secure. Dermal Anchor piercings are typically done with a medical grade punch biopsy instrument. As the name suggests, this instrument is commonly used by physicians to remove a precise area of soft tissue for medical assessment, or biopsy. The punch biopsy is pressed firmly against the skin to create an opening in the skin for the base of the anchor. Healing of this piercing usually takes 8 - 12 weeks.
